Hot Wheels 2025 RLC Exclusive sELECTIONs 1968 Custom Plymouth Barracuda
The 1968 Custom Plymouth Barracuda is the sELECTIONs #1 car for 2025. It’s an original take of a Hot Wheels Original 16 casting, with high-octane upgrades over the more recent 2016 edition. Designer Phil Riehlman reveals the inspiration behind his winning design: “The car is a vision of what I’d do with my ’68 notchback Barracuda if money was no objects, with custom body work including flairs, rear spoiler, front spoiler, and front splitter.”
* Opening bonnet
* Body Colour: Spectraflame antifreeze Green
